Service overview
Soft or crumbling timber needs more than a coat of paint. Fix Nik can assess local deterioration in suitable non-structural trim and small timber pieces, checking whether a limited repair is practical. This service does not cover structural decay, pest treatment or a diagnosis of concealed building damage.
Softness near a load-bearing member, deck support or an unstable assembly changes the nature of the enquiry. Do not probe, remove or load questionable material to investigate it yourself. Send safe photographs and explain where the affected timber is located.
Finishing should be planned with the repair rather than added as an assumption. Preparation, coating compatibility and drying conditions affect the result. A quote can distinguish timber replacement or repair from painting and from any specialist work needed to address the cause.
